The Tomcat version doesn't really matter. The mod_jk binaries for 3.2.x have this problem. Upgrading to the 3.3.x mod_jk binaries should solve this (whether you are running 3.2.x, 3.3.x, or 4.x.x).
There should be new binaries for mod_jk 1.2 (the 3.3 version = 1.1) on the Jakarta site later this week, or early next.
